Transaction dce61fb387926b8967413e809722f85e291041a491eca309bec994cb01e6c725
1 Input
1 Output
-
dce61fb387926b8967413e809722f85e291041a491eca309bec994cb01e6c725:0
- value
- 1085003
- script pubkey
- OP_0 OP_PUSHBYTES_20 1aaef6d4c0bca2458eea5872554792dcb0208a4a
- address
- bc1qr2h0d4xqhj3ytrh2tpe923ujmjczpzj2vvz3qx